61 |
Anpassung und Implementierung verschiedener Transaktionsprotokolle auf WS-CoordinationVetter, Thorsten. January 2006 (has links)
Stuttgart, Univ., Diplomarbeit, 2006.
|
62 |
Performance measurements of Web servicesDamaraju, Sarita. January 2006 (has links)
Thesis (M.S.)--West Virginia University, 2006. / Title from document title page. Document formatted into pages; contains v, 42 p. : ill. (some col.). Includes abstract. Includes bibliographical references (p. 32-34).
|
63 |
Client utilization study for comm5 web systemsWichmann, Amy L. January 2006 (has links) (PDF)
Thesis PlanB (M.S.)--University of Wisconsin--Stout, 2006. / Includes bibliographical references.
|
64 |
Tecnologia computacional de apoio a rastreabilidade biométrica de bovinos / Computer technology to support bovines biometric traceabilityLeick, Walter da Silva 13 October 2016 (has links)
O Brasil é um dos maiores produtores e exportadores de carne bovina do planeta e com a expectativa de ser responsável por 45% do consumo mundial sendo que a maior parte de seu consumo ainda é local. Para se manter nesta posição e expandir suas vendas tanto no mercado interno como externo é importante que se garanta a qualidade do produto. Esta qualidade só é conseguida quando se consegue gerenciar todo o processo da cadeia produtiva, de forma a permitir o registro de todos os dados do animal na cadeia de produção. Tanto o governo através do SISBOV como grandes distribuidores possuem sistemas de gerenciamento que através de técnicas de rastreabilidade permitem ter este controle. A identificação do animal é ponto chave para a rastreabilidade que hoje é feita através de bottons, transponders, brincos entre outros. Todos estes métodos são invasivos e suscetíveis a perdas e adulterações. Esta dissertação mostra a viabilidade de inserir em sistemas de rastreabilidade existentes ou não a inclusão de identificação biométrica e usa como exemplo o focinho nasal do bovino. Para tanto desenvolveu-se programas para entrada de informações através de um celular com sistema operacional Android que em conjunto com programas desenvolvidos para rodarem na WEB pudessem cadastrar e confirmar a identidade do animal. Os testes mostraram a capacidade do aplicativo Android em localizar o espelho nasal e coletar o mesmo. Com os dados coletados foi possível armazenar as informações ou confirmar a identidade do animal por meio dos serviços do servidor. Mostrou-se desta forma viável a utilização deste tipo de identificação em sistemas de gerenciamento novos ou já existentes. / Brazil is one of the largest producers and exporters of beef in the world and with the expectation of being responsible for 45% of global consumption and the largest part of consumption is still locall. To stay in this position and to expand its sales both in domestic and foreign markets is important to ensure product quality. This quality is achieved only when you can manage the entire process of the production chain in order to allow the registration of all animal data in the production chain. The government through SISBOV and large distributors have been working with management systems through traceability techniques. Animal identification is key to the traceability and nowadays is made via bottoms, transponders, earrings among others. All these methods are invasive and susceptible to loss and tampering. This work shows the feasibility of entering into existing traceability systems or not the inclusion of biometric identification and uses as an example the nasal muzzle beef. For both developed programs to input information through a mobile phone with Android operating system in conjunction with programs designed to be web based solution could register and confirm the identity of the animal. All results was able to shown the system performance by showing that it was possible to store the information or confirm the identity of the animal through the server services. The methodology proposed could be useful in commercial applications focusing in bovine traceability.
|
65 |
Distribuição de carga flexível e dinâmica para provedores de web services / Dynamic and flexible load distribution for web service clustersMatos, Jonathan de 16 April 2009 (has links)
A SOA está se tornando uma abordagem difundida no desenvolvimento de sistemas. Em sistemas maiores onde se utiliza SOA pode ocorrer problemas de alta demanda, que podem ser resolvidos com arquiteturas distribuídas como clusters. Esta dissertação apresenta a proposta de uma nova arquitetura para distribuição de requisições em clusters de web services. A arquitetura proposta tem foco na distribuição flexível de requisições, possibilitando o emprego de políticas diversificadas, estas voltadas a diferentes objetivos, aplicações e plataformas. A arquitetura também propõe trabalhar de forma dinâmica, possibilitando decisões baseadas na coleta de estado dos elementos que compõem a estrutura de atendimento. A transparência, do ponto de vista do cliente, também é tratada na arquitetura. Os testes da arquitetura foram realizados através de um protótipo que a implementa. O protótipo instancia os objetivos propostos na arquitetura, apresentando ganhos de desempenho em relação à solução existente atualmente. A flexibilidade das políticas de distribuição é destacada através da construção de uma política, cujo objetivo é melhorar a eficiência no consumo de energia de clusters. Dentre as contribuições do trabalho está a criação de uma nova arquitetura de software que atua como facilitadora para a criação de políticas de distribuição de requisições mais eficiente para web services / SOA is becoming a widespread approach to develop systems. High demand problems may appear in huge systems where SOA and web services are used. This problems can be solved by means of distributed architectures like clusters. This work presents the proposal of a new architecture for request distribution in web service clusters. The proposed architecture provides flexible request distribution. It allows the use of several policies, these related to different objectives, applications and platforms. The architecture\'s dynamic feature enables decisions based on states of the cluster\'s elements, in a transparent way, under clients\' point of view. The architecture was tested using a prototype that implements the proposed ideas in this work. The objectives of the proposal were reached by the prototype and still shown performance improving in many cases, when comparing to an existing solution. The use of a novel policy, related to energetic efficiency for clusters, is also shown on the experiments related to flexibility. Among architecture\'s contributions is a novel software architecture that acts as a facility to create and to test more efficient web services policies
|
66 |
Utilização de serviços na integração de aplicações empresariais / Utilization of services in enterprise application integrationKaneshima, Eliana 30 November 2012 (has links)
Atualmente a Integração de Aplicações Empresariais (EAI) desempenha um papel fundamental no cenário de integração de sistemas corporativos. Isso pode ser feito de diferentes formas, como por exemplo, por meio do compartilhamento de acesso às bases de dados ou trabalhando-se com Web Services, em que um serviço é disponibilizado por um sistema e pode ser chamado por outro sistema a ser integrado. Essas duas soluções estão sendo empregadas com sucesso, mas ambas apresentam vantagens e desvantagens que devem ser analisadas. Assim, este trabalho tem como objetivo primeiramente efetuar uma comparação entre essas duas abordagens de integração (tomando como base a norma ISO-IEC 9126-1) por meio de uma revisão bibliográfica complementada por uma revisão sistemática e relatos da experiência profissional da autora deste trabalho e da sua orientadora. Com o intuito de validar esta comparação, foi feito um estudo experimental, cujo objetivo do experimento foi avaliar a melhor abordagem para se realizar uma integração de aplicações empresariais: EAI-Dados e EAI-WS no que diz respeito ao esforço necessário para a implantação de cada uma. Assim, a avaliação foi realizada para responder à seguinte questão: Em termos de tempo de desenvolvimento e código produzido, é mais fácil realizar EAI-WS ou EAI-Dados? Finalmente, foram propostos cinco padrões para EAI, com o objetivo de auxiliar desenvolvedores com problemas similares de integração de aplicações. Esses padrões podem ser reusados em diversos contextos de integração, obedecendo às regras de negócios específicas a serem consideradas no momento da integração, e agilizando a modelagem da solução por meio da instanciação do padrão mais adequado a cada situação / Nowadays, Enterprise Applications Integration (EAI) performs a fundamental function in the scenery of enterprise systems integration. This can be done in different forms, for example by sharing the database access or working with Web Services, in which a service is provided by the system and can be called by other systems to be integrated. Those two solutions are being applied successfully, even though both present advantages and disadvantages that must be analyzed. Thus, the goal of this work is first to compare those two integration approaches, (Based on the standard ISO-IEC 9126-1) through a bibliographical review complemented by a systematic review and professional reports from the author of this work and her supervisor. In order to confirm this comparison, an experimental study was done, which resulted in quantitative answers about the best approach to perform systems integration: EAI-Data and EAI-WS which refer to effort required to deploy each. Thus, the assessment was conducted to answer the following question: In terms of development time and code produced, is easier to perform EAI-WS or EAI-Data? Finally, five patterns were proposed to EAI, which aim to support developers with similar problems of applications integration. These patterns can be reused in many integration contexts, following the rules of specific business to be considered in the moment of integration, and accelerating the modeling of the solution through the instantiation of the most adequate pattern to each situation
|
67 |
Distribuição de carga flexível e dinâmica para provedores de web services / Dynamic and flexible load distribution for web service clustersJonathan de Matos 16 April 2009 (has links)
A SOA está se tornando uma abordagem difundida no desenvolvimento de sistemas. Em sistemas maiores onde se utiliza SOA pode ocorrer problemas de alta demanda, que podem ser resolvidos com arquiteturas distribuídas como clusters. Esta dissertação apresenta a proposta de uma nova arquitetura para distribuição de requisições em clusters de web services. A arquitetura proposta tem foco na distribuição flexível de requisições, possibilitando o emprego de políticas diversificadas, estas voltadas a diferentes objetivos, aplicações e plataformas. A arquitetura também propõe trabalhar de forma dinâmica, possibilitando decisões baseadas na coleta de estado dos elementos que compõem a estrutura de atendimento. A transparência, do ponto de vista do cliente, também é tratada na arquitetura. Os testes da arquitetura foram realizados através de um protótipo que a implementa. O protótipo instancia os objetivos propostos na arquitetura, apresentando ganhos de desempenho em relação à solução existente atualmente. A flexibilidade das políticas de distribuição é destacada através da construção de uma política, cujo objetivo é melhorar a eficiência no consumo de energia de clusters. Dentre as contribuições do trabalho está a criação de uma nova arquitetura de software que atua como facilitadora para a criação de políticas de distribuição de requisições mais eficiente para web services / SOA is becoming a widespread approach to develop systems. High demand problems may appear in huge systems where SOA and web services are used. This problems can be solved by means of distributed architectures like clusters. This work presents the proposal of a new architecture for request distribution in web service clusters. The proposed architecture provides flexible request distribution. It allows the use of several policies, these related to different objectives, applications and platforms. The architecture\'s dynamic feature enables decisions based on states of the cluster\'s elements, in a transparent way, under clients\' point of view. The architecture was tested using a prototype that implements the proposed ideas in this work. The objectives of the proposal were reached by the prototype and still shown performance improving in many cases, when comparing to an existing solution. The use of a novel policy, related to energetic efficiency for clusters, is also shown on the experiments related to flexibility. Among architecture\'s contributions is a novel software architecture that acts as a facility to create and to test more efficient web services policies
|
68 |
Tecnologia computacional de apoio a rastreabilidade biométrica de bovinos / Computer technology to support bovines biometric traceabilityWalter da Silva Leick 13 October 2016 (has links)
O Brasil é um dos maiores produtores e exportadores de carne bovina do planeta e com a expectativa de ser responsável por 45% do consumo mundial sendo que a maior parte de seu consumo ainda é local. Para se manter nesta posição e expandir suas vendas tanto no mercado interno como externo é importante que se garanta a qualidade do produto. Esta qualidade só é conseguida quando se consegue gerenciar todo o processo da cadeia produtiva, de forma a permitir o registro de todos os dados do animal na cadeia de produção. Tanto o governo através do SISBOV como grandes distribuidores possuem sistemas de gerenciamento que através de técnicas de rastreabilidade permitem ter este controle. A identificação do animal é ponto chave para a rastreabilidade que hoje é feita através de bottons, transponders, brincos entre outros. Todos estes métodos são invasivos e suscetíveis a perdas e adulterações. Esta dissertação mostra a viabilidade de inserir em sistemas de rastreabilidade existentes ou não a inclusão de identificação biométrica e usa como exemplo o focinho nasal do bovino. Para tanto desenvolveu-se programas para entrada de informações através de um celular com sistema operacional Android que em conjunto com programas desenvolvidos para rodarem na WEB pudessem cadastrar e confirmar a identidade do animal. Os testes mostraram a capacidade do aplicativo Android em localizar o espelho nasal e coletar o mesmo. Com os dados coletados foi possível armazenar as informações ou confirmar a identidade do animal por meio dos serviços do servidor. Mostrou-se desta forma viável a utilização deste tipo de identificação em sistemas de gerenciamento novos ou já existentes. / Brazil is one of the largest producers and exporters of beef in the world and with the expectation of being responsible for 45% of global consumption and the largest part of consumption is still locall. To stay in this position and to expand its sales both in domestic and foreign markets is important to ensure product quality. This quality is achieved only when you can manage the entire process of the production chain in order to allow the registration of all animal data in the production chain. The government through SISBOV and large distributors have been working with management systems through traceability techniques. Animal identification is key to the traceability and nowadays is made via bottoms, transponders, earrings among others. All these methods are invasive and susceptible to loss and tampering. This work shows the feasibility of entering into existing traceability systems or not the inclusion of biometric identification and uses as an example the nasal muzzle beef. For both developed programs to input information through a mobile phone with Android operating system in conjunction with programs designed to be web based solution could register and confirm the identity of the animal. All results was able to shown the system performance by showing that it was possible to store the information or confirm the identity of the animal through the server services. The methodology proposed could be useful in commercial applications focusing in bovine traceability.
|
69 |
Analysis of Web Services on J2EE Application ServersGosu, Adarsh Kumar 05 1900 (has links)
The Internet became a standard way of exchanging business data between B2B and B2C applications and with this came the need for providing various services on the web instead of just static text and images. Web services are a new type of services offered via the web that aid in the creation of globally distributed applications. Web services are enhanced e-business applications that are easier to advertise and easier to discover on the Internet because of their flexibility and uniformity. In a real life scenario it is highly difficult to decide which J2EE application server to go for when deploying a enterprise web service. This thesis analyzes the various ways by which web services can be developed & deployed. Underlying protocols and crucial issues like EAI (enterprise application integration), asynchronous messaging, Registry tModel architecture etc have been considered in this research. This paper presents a report by analyzing what various J2EE application servers provide by doing a case study and by developing applications to test functionality.
|
70 |
Utilização de serviços na integração de aplicações empresariais / Utilization of services in enterprise application integrationEliana Kaneshima 30 November 2012 (has links)
Atualmente a Integração de Aplicações Empresariais (EAI) desempenha um papel fundamental no cenário de integração de sistemas corporativos. Isso pode ser feito de diferentes formas, como por exemplo, por meio do compartilhamento de acesso às bases de dados ou trabalhando-se com Web Services, em que um serviço é disponibilizado por um sistema e pode ser chamado por outro sistema a ser integrado. Essas duas soluções estão sendo empregadas com sucesso, mas ambas apresentam vantagens e desvantagens que devem ser analisadas. Assim, este trabalho tem como objetivo primeiramente efetuar uma comparação entre essas duas abordagens de integração (tomando como base a norma ISO-IEC 9126-1) por meio de uma revisão bibliográfica complementada por uma revisão sistemática e relatos da experiência profissional da autora deste trabalho e da sua orientadora. Com o intuito de validar esta comparação, foi feito um estudo experimental, cujo objetivo do experimento foi avaliar a melhor abordagem para se realizar uma integração de aplicações empresariais: EAI-Dados e EAI-WS no que diz respeito ao esforço necessário para a implantação de cada uma. Assim, a avaliação foi realizada para responder à seguinte questão: Em termos de tempo de desenvolvimento e código produzido, é mais fácil realizar EAI-WS ou EAI-Dados? Finalmente, foram propostos cinco padrões para EAI, com o objetivo de auxiliar desenvolvedores com problemas similares de integração de aplicações. Esses padrões podem ser reusados em diversos contextos de integração, obedecendo às regras de negócios específicas a serem consideradas no momento da integração, e agilizando a modelagem da solução por meio da instanciação do padrão mais adequado a cada situação / Nowadays, Enterprise Applications Integration (EAI) performs a fundamental function in the scenery of enterprise systems integration. This can be done in different forms, for example by sharing the database access or working with Web Services, in which a service is provided by the system and can be called by other systems to be integrated. Those two solutions are being applied successfully, even though both present advantages and disadvantages that must be analyzed. Thus, the goal of this work is first to compare those two integration approaches, (Based on the standard ISO-IEC 9126-1) through a bibliographical review complemented by a systematic review and professional reports from the author of this work and her supervisor. In order to confirm this comparison, an experimental study was done, which resulted in quantitative answers about the best approach to perform systems integration: EAI-Data and EAI-WS which refer to effort required to deploy each. Thus, the assessment was conducted to answer the following question: In terms of development time and code produced, is easier to perform EAI-WS or EAI-Data? Finally, five patterns were proposed to EAI, which aim to support developers with similar problems of applications integration. These patterns can be reused in many integration contexts, following the rules of specific business to be considered in the moment of integration, and accelerating the modeling of the solution through the instantiation of the most adequate pattern to each situation
|
Page generated in 0.1143 seconds